Output 55f8dba7e53160495b6895abba253d22c7e4fc99f2d898cfe42c281ebd6c2c19:2

value
10857300
script pubkey
OP_0 OP_PUSHBYTES_20 52f077c0eb865a6fda591832eb13a1c7b027754f
address
bc1q2tc80s8tsedxlkjerqewkyapc7czwa20y79qep
transaction
55f8dba7e53160495b6895abba253d22c7e4fc99f2d898cfe42c281ebd6c2c19
confirmations
242340
spent
true